I really enjoyed this book.  As a women in STEM I feel like I really related to the main character in a lot of ways.  She is very autistic coded and just fits a bunch of stereo types, but she grows in really nice ways in the book.  I feel it is never forced or felt like it didn't feel like the next logical step in her progression and her flaws are not what I thought drove the story.  

The Faerie and Magic system in this book is really nice.  Gives like the things you see in the corner of your eye as a kid or adult that give you pause rather than being overt.  It is an interesting book and my love of the setting and characters gave it the 4.75.  I feel like the plot at the end lost me, but it worked fine.  I am looking forward to reading the next book in the series.
